Gas Guzzler Tax
If you buy a car with low
gas mileage there is an
extra tax you must pay
The Energy Tax Act of 1978
established a Gas Guzzler
Tax on the sale of new model
year vehicles whose fuel
economy fails to meet
certain statutory levels.
The gas guzzler tax applies
only to cars (not trucks)
and is collected by the IRS.

A federal "gas guzzler" tax
is collected on new
automobiles that have a fuel
economy rating of less than
22.5 miles-per-gallon (MPG).
Minivans, sports utility
vehicles, and automobiles
weighing more than 6,000
pounds are exempt from the
tax. Because of the
exemptions, very few
vehicles are subject to the
tax. The tax ranges
from $1,000 for automobiles
with MPG standards of
between 21.5 and 22.5 to
$7,700 for vehicles with MPG
standards of less than 12.5.
The fuel economy figures
used to determine the Gas
Guzzler Tax are different
from the fuel economy values
from the EPA. The tax
does not depend on you
actual on-the-road mpg,
which may be more or less
than the EPA published
value. The purpose of the
Gas Guzzler Tax is to
discourage the production
and purchase of fuel
inefficient vehicles.
The amount of any applicable
Gas Guzzler Tax paid by the
manufacturer will be
disclosed on the
automobile's fuel economy
label (the window sticker on
new cars).

The combined fuel
economy MPG value
(55% city, 45%
highway) is used to
determine the tax
liability. The
MPG value is also
adjusted slightly to
account for
differences in test
procedures since the
base year.
The MPG is not
adjusted for in-use
short fall.
The unadjusted
combined MPG of a
vehicle can be
approximated from
the city and highway
values provided in
the Fuel Economy
Guide by the
following equation:
(1/(.495/city
MPG + .351/Highway
MPG)) + .15
Check out the
actual tax code in
Section 4064. |

GAS GUZZLER
TAX |
|
Unadjusted
MPG
(combined) |
Tax |
|
at least
22.5 |
No Tax |
|
at least
21.5, but
less than
22.5 |
$1,000 |
|
at least
20.5, but
less than
21.5 |
$1,300 |
|
at least
19.5, but
less than
20.5 |
$1,700 |
|
at least
18.5, but
less than
19.5 |
$2,100 |
|
at least
17.5, but
less than
18.5 |
$2,600 |
|
at least
16.5, but
less than
17.5 |
$3,000 |
|
at least
15.5, but
less than
16.5 |
$3,700 |
|
at least
14.5, but
less than
15.5 |
$4,500 |
|
at least
13.5, but
less than
14.5 |
$5,400 |
|
at least
12.5, but
less than
13.5 |
$6,400 |
|
less than
12.5 |
$7,700 |

Vehicles subject to
the Gas Guzzler Tax |
|
Vehicle |
Tax |
| 2005
Audi A8 |
$1,700 |
| 2005
Audi S4 |
$1,700 |
| 2006
BMW 7-Series |
$1,700 |
| 2005
Dodge Viper |
$3,000 |
| 2005
Ford GT |
$2,100 |
| 2006
Jaguar XK |
$1,000 |
| 2006
Mercedes Benz CL500 |
$1,000 |
| 2006
Mercedes Benz CL600 |
$2,600 |
| 2006
Mercedes Benz CL55
AMG |
$1,700 |
| 2006
Mercedes Benz CL65
AMG |
$2,600 |
| 2005
Mercedes Benz SL500 |
$1,300 |
| 2005
Mercedes Benz SL55
AMG |
$2,100 |
| 2005
Mercedes Benz SL600 |
$2,600 |
| 2005
Mercedes Benz SL65
AMG |
$3,000 |
| 2006
Pontiac GTO |
$1,300 |
| 2005
Volkswagen Phaeton
4D Sedan 4-seater V8 |
$1,300 |
| 2005
Volkswagen Phaeton
4D Sedan 4-seater
V12 |
$3,000 |
| 2005
Volkswagen Phaeton
4D Sedan V8 |
$1,300 |
| 2005
Volkswagen Phaeton
4D Sedan W12 |
$3,000 |
